Summary
One of H. G. Wells' dystopian science fiction novels, The Sleeper Awakes deals with a topic we have seen on film so many times: a man falls into a coma as a result of the medication he takes for his insomnia and wakes up 203 years later to a London and a world he doesn't know anymore. Many things have changed since Graham took his sleeping pills. He became wealthy while he was asleep - his inheritance was handled by trustees who used the money to successfully establish a new world order. Graham's awakening causes a lot of confusion - Graham himself is completely disoriented in the beginning and everyone around him is confused by the unexpected event
